Are Black Remedy Acceptable to Use in Australia?
The acceptance of black salve remedy, particularly imported from overseas, has raised considerable concern regarding its security within this nation. To date, the Therapeutic Goods Administration (TGA) has not endorse black salve compounds for specific skin condition. The primary substance – typically a combination of bloodroot and other herbs – features powerful compounds able to destroy damaged skin structures, which might lead to significant complications, including tissue damage. Consequently, healthcare professionals generally caution against its application and highlight the hazards involved without proper medical direction.

Drawing Salve Australia: Comprehending the Rules
The sale of black salve ointment in Australia is governed by complex laws, making it a difficult landscape for both buyers and producers. Currently, the Therapeutic Goods Administration (TGA) does not classify such product as a registered medicine, resulting in varying levels of regulation. While some ingredients, like ichthammol, can be found in approved medications, the blend often used in black salve ointments for skin cleansing falls outside established regulatory frameworks. Consequently, it’s crucial for individuals to thoroughly research the legal status before obtaining or using such ointments and to discuss with a licensed medical practitioner regarding potential risks.
